Skrill – All the important information

Skrill is one of the most popular payment options and was formerly known as Moneybookers. It works in over 200 countries with 40 different currencies and as one of the most popular payment methods, you have a large selection of casinos from which to choose. Once you have selected your online casino, you sign-up with Skrill using a checking account or credit card. Their security is top-notch and your financial information is never shared with the casino so you can rest easy. Payments are prompt and can be transferred into your account or to your bank. Although fees are charged, their bonuses and rewards programs are generous.

Paypal is a site not only popular with online casinos but thousands of online vendors as well so has added versatility. Similar to Skrill, there is a huge selection of casinos that accept Paypal and because of their tight security and the fact that your financial information is never shared with the casino, your money is secure. You can transfer money into your Paypal account either from a credit card or your bank account and then instantly use the funds at the casino of your choice. Your winnings can be deposited back into your Paypal account and deposited onto your credit card, into your checking account or onto a free Paypal card. The drawback is that Paypal services cannot currently be used in the United States, Canada and Australia.

And of course the Bank Cards

Bank Cards, whether debit or credit, are accepted at a large number of online casinos around the world. However, due to restrictions put in place by some card issuers, you will have to check that your particular card can be used. Debit cards are easy to use as you can usually directly withdrawal funds from them. In addition, the PIN adds security and you will not have the option to overspend. Casinos will charge a transaction fee when using a debit card but may also offer bonuses. On the other hand, casinos do not usually charge a fee for credit cards, but your card issuer usually will. Credit cards do offer additional protection as banks will usually cover any fraudulent charges.
